New Removal Report Lays Out Facts about Malicious Windows Daily Adviser Rogue & How To Remove It

Windows Daily Adviser, mimicking legitimate antivirus applications, is a malicious program created by hackers to trick PC users out of money through false positives and deceptive warning messages.

May 7, 2012 - PRLog -- Windows Daily Adviser is in fact a fake security program that may closely resemble legitimate antivirus apps on the software market. The hackers who created Windows Daily Adviser purposely incorporated such an enticing interface to foil PC users to the point that they end up purchasing a registered version of Windows Daily Adviser.

A newly released removal report, found on EnigmaSoftware.com, outlines what Windows Daily Adviser does and where it may come from. In knowing this information about Windows Daily Adviser, it will arm PC users with the necessary resources and intelligence to successfully un-install the Windows Daily Adviser program.

Users who have Windows Daily Adviser installed on their system have faced a virtual dead end in trying to remove it. This is because Windows Daily Adviser was created to stay resident on a system for as long as it can to fulfill its duty of selling itself to gullible PC users. Because of this, many trusted security outlets on the internet have released removal reports and removal guides addressing the need for these users to completely remove the Windows Daily Adviser program. Windows Daily Adviser is not a program that should be used to detect and remove viruses or other malware from a computer.
